But, on the third hand, we do try to be helpful. Wiser monks may provide a more specific or detailed answer, but you might do well to look at the documentation for:
- PGP-FindKey
Perl interface to finding PGP keyids from e-mail addresses.
Version: 0.02
- PGP-Sign
Create and verify PGP/GnuPG signatures, securely
Version: 0.17
in CPAN or Active State, depending on your OS, skills and preferences.
